Understanding Hair Transfer: What It Is and How It Works
Hair transfer, also known as hair transplant or hair implantation, is a surgical procedure that involves relocating hair follicles from a dense, healthy region (commonly the back or sides of the scalp) to areas affected by hair thinning or baldness. This procedure leverages the natural growth potential of hair follicles, creating a permanent, natural-looking hairline that seamlessly blends with existing hair.
The Evolution of Hair Transfer Techniques
Over the years, hair transfer methods have evolved significantly, incorporating cutting-edge technologies and refined surgical techniques to enhance effectiveness, reduce pain, and improve aesthetic outcomes. The most prominent techniques include:
-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T): Involves strip harvesting of a scalp section followed by meticulous follicle dissection.
-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E): A minimally invasive method that extracts individual follicular units directly from the donor area.
- Robotic Hair Transplantation: Utilizes robotic assistance to improve precision and reduce human error during extraction and implantation.

The Process of Hair Transfer: What Patients Can Expect

1. Consultation and Planning
All successful hair transfer procedures begin with a comprehensive consultation. During this phase, medical professionals evaluate the patient’s scalp condition, donor hair quality, and overall health. They also discuss aesthetic goals to determine the optimal number of grafts and the best hairline design, ensuring natural and proportionate results.
2. Preoperative Preparation
Patients are advised on preoperative care, which may include avoiding blood-thinning medications, alcohol, and smoking to optimize healing and minimize risks. Hair trimming in the donor area may also be performed to facilitate extraction.
3. Anesthesia and Sedation
Local anesthesia is administered to ensure patient comfort throughout the procedure. Sedation options may be provided for anxious patients.
4. Extracting Donor Hair
Depending on the selected technique:
- FUT method: A thin strip of scalp tissue is carefully removed from the donor site and dissected into follicular units.
- FUE method: Individual follicular units are extracted directly from the scalp via tiny punch tools.
5. Creating Recipient Sites
Next, the surgeon makes small incisions in the balding or thinning area, carefully selecting angles, directions, and densities to mimic natural hair growth patterns.
6. Implantation of Hair Follicles
The extracted follicles are then meticulously implanted into the recipient sites, ensuring uniformity and a natural flow.
7. Postoperative Care and Recovery
After the procedure, patients receive detailed instructions regarding medications, hygiene, and activity restrictions. Initial swelling or minor discomfort is normal and subsides within a few days to a week. Most patients can return to work shortly after the procedure, with full healing taking several months.
Post-Procedure Expectations and Results
Within the first few weeks, transplanted hair may fall out — a normal part of the hair cycle — followed by new hair growth starting around 3 to 4 months. Visible, fuller, and natural hair density emerges typically between 6 to 12 months post-surgery. The results are permanent, and transplanted hair continues to grow and respond like normal scalp hair.

Who Are Ideal Candidates for Hair Transfer?
While hair transfer can benefit a wide range of individuals, the ideal candidates typically include those who:
- Have stable hair loss patterns and sufficient donor hair.
- Are in good overall health with no contraindicating medical conditions.
- Have realistic expectations about the outcome.
- Are seeking a permanent solution to hair loss.
It is essential for prospective patients to consult with qualified medical professionals to determine their candidacy through detailed scalp assessments and health evaluations.
